Medicare. it was voting rights. it was civil rights. it was the head start program. it was that consumer product safety commission that we just heard about. it was college loans. it was the first environmental protections we ever had as a country. it was food stamps. lyndon johnson 50 years ago today laid out that vision of what he wanted to do as president and what he thought america could do with its wealth. and then the 89th congress, which met from 1965 to 1967 set about enacting that program. enacting that vision. to this day, that congress remains the most productive congress in the history of the united states. no legislative session has ever done more than that congress did. karen at the washington post did a look at that speech 50 years ago today and what president johnson promised and they did that lookback in part because president johnson said in that speech that if this program of his was going to be followed, he believed that it ....

Men of needed skill and talent were denied entrance because they came from southern or eastern europe or from one of the developing continents. this system violated the basic principle of american democracy. the principle that values and rewards each man on the basis of his merit as a man. it has been unamerican in the high sense. today, with my signature, this system is abolished. lyndon johnson in 1965 signing one of the hugely consequential pieces of legislation sent to him by that most productive congress in the history of congress. today 50 years later we currently have the least productive congress in the history of congress. ....
